max_hash_mem
参数名称
max_hash_mem
参数解释
允许单个哈希节点使用的最大内存量(单位:MB)。
SGA内存(system_sga_mem)为共享资源,所有排序、哈希、集合等都会使用,为避免单个任务将内存资源耗尽,其他任务无法成功执行,系统通过该参数控制单次计算的最大内存开销,保证数据库系统利用有限资源最大化对外服务能力。
默认值
32
取值范围
[32,1048576]
访问权限
R/W
是否全局参数
是
修改生效方式
max_hash_mem不支持在数据库中执行SET命令修改,只能通过修改xugu.ini文件,重启系统后生效。
操作步骤
- 在数据库中执行以下命令中止数据库服务,退出控制台工具。
SQL> SHUTDOWN
- 修改SETUP文件夹下xugu.ini文件中的max_hash_mem参数,根据实际需求在取值范围内选择合适的参数值,保存并退出。
- 重新启动数据库服务。
- 在数据库中执行以下命令查看当前参数值。
SQL> SHOW max_hash_mem
注意事项
无